Azure Service Fabric is a distributed systems platform developed by Microsoft, designed to simplify the packaging, deployment, and management of scalable and reliable microservices and containers. Its history dates back to 2015 when it was first introduced as part of Microsoft's cloud computing service, Azure. Initially, it was used internally to power various Microsoft services, including Azure SQL Database and Skype for Business. Over time, Microsoft opened up Service Fabric to external developers, allowing them to build their own applications on the platform. The technology has evolved significantly, incorporating features like support for container orchestration, improved monitoring tools, and enhanced integration with other Azure services, making it a robust solution for modern application development. **Brief Answer:** Azure Service Fabric, launched in 2015 by Microsoft, is a distributed systems platform that facilitates the development and management of microservices and containers. Initially used internally by Microsoft, it was later made available to external developers and has since evolved to include advanced features for application development and deployment.
Azure Service Fabric is a distributed systems platform that simplifies the packaging, deployment, and management of scalable and reliable microservices. One of its primary advantages is its ability to support both stateless and stateful services, allowing developers to build applications that can maintain state across sessions. Additionally, it offers robust orchestration capabilities, automatic scaling, and high availability, which enhance application resilience. However, there are disadvantages as well; the learning curve can be steep for teams unfamiliar with microservices architecture, and managing complex deployments may require significant operational overhead. Furthermore, while Azure Service Fabric provides powerful tools, it may not be necessary for simpler applications, leading to potential over-engineering. In summary, Azure Service Fabric offers scalability and reliability for microservices but comes with a steep learning curve and potential complexity for simpler projects.
Azure Service Fabric, while a powerful platform for building and managing microservices applications, presents several challenges that developers and organizations must navigate. One significant challenge is the complexity of its architecture, which can lead to a steep learning curve for teams unfamiliar with microservices or distributed systems. Additionally, managing stateful services can be intricate, requiring careful consideration of data consistency and reliability. Debugging and monitoring applications in a Service Fabric environment can also be more complicated compared to traditional architectures, as issues may arise from the interactions between numerous microservices. Furthermore, scaling applications effectively while maintaining performance and cost efficiency can pose difficulties, especially during peak loads. Lastly, ensuring security across multiple services and managing service dependencies adds another layer of complexity. **Brief Answer:** The challenges of Azure Service Fabric include its complex architecture, difficulties in managing stateful services, complications in debugging and monitoring, scaling issues, and ensuring security across multiple microservices.
Finding talent or assistance with Azure Service Fabric can be crucial for organizations looking to leverage this powerful platform for building and managing microservices applications. Azure Service Fabric is a distributed systems platform that simplifies the packaging, deployment, and management of scalable and reliable applications. To locate skilled professionals, companies can explore various avenues such as job boards, LinkedIn, and specialized tech recruitment agencies. Additionally, engaging with online communities, forums, and user groups focused on Azure technologies can provide valuable insights and connections. For immediate help, consulting Microsoft’s official documentation, tutorials, and support services can also be beneficial. **Brief Answer:** To find talent or help with Azure Service Fabric, consider using job boards, LinkedIn, tech recruitment agencies, and engaging with online communities. For immediate assistance, refer to Microsoft's official documentation and support services.
Easiio stands at the forefront of technological innovation, offering a comprehensive suite of software development services tailored to meet the demands of today's digital landscape. Our expertise spans across advanced domains such as Machine Learning, Neural Networks, Blockchain, Cryptocurrency, Large Language Model (LLM) applications, and sophisticated algorithms. By leveraging these cutting-edge technologies, Easiio crafts bespoke solutions that drive business success and efficiency. To explore our offerings or to initiate a service request, we invite you to visit our software development page.
TEL:866-460-7666
EMAIL:contact@easiio.com
ADD.:11501 Dublin Blvd. Suite 200, Dublin, CA, 94568